The Purpose of Local Storage

Cookies are simple text files stored on your device that allow our platform to recognize your preferences over time. For a firm specializing in analytics, these files are essential for distinguishing between unique sessions and returning researchers.

Without these identifiers, the data insights we generate about our own site performance would lose the context required to improve our user interface and content delivery.

Managing Your Digital Footprint

CoreAsean Analytics respects the sovereign right of every user to control their browsing data. While most web browsers are set to accept cookies by default, you can adjust these settings to alert you when a cookie is stored or to block them entirely.

If you choose to disable performance and experience cookies, please be aware that certain deep-dive analytics features and interactive sectors may not function as intended. We recommend ensuring that mandatory core cookies remain active to maintain site security during your session.

To prune your existing data profile, visit your browser settings (usually located in "Privacy" or "Security" menus) and select "Clear Browsing Data" or "Delete Cookies." This action is immediate and absolute for that specific device.
